`
281601139
  • 浏览: 16402 次
  • 性别: Icon_minigender_1
  • 来自: 福建厦门
文章分类
社区版块
存档分类
最新评论
文章列表
composite是树形结构,那么我下面就用树的结构来写代码,希望对大家有所帮助 ======================================================================   //分支 public interface Brache { public void run();}   ============================================================ ...
我们经常要使用select ,但select的大小会随着内容的大小而变化。很烦人啊。 网上有人说用层来替代,这个方法是可行的,就是觉得有点麻烦。 本人喜欢投机取巧。。呵呵 所以想了个懒办法--用脚本控制 当select被点击(onclick或者onchange)的时候调用脚本函数改变这个select的width值 当select失去焦点(onblur)的时候再一次调用脚本恢复这个select的width值。 <select id="linjunhong" name="xiamen" onclick="changeWidth()& ...
一个action类中有执行增删改查的操作,有时候在增的时候需要验证而在删除的时候不需要验证数据的有效性,但是又不得不去把参数写完整。 访问的时候XXXXAction?method=add或XXXXAction?method=remove 现在稍微修改一下,在配置的时候分成连个表示方式: action path=&quot;/addAction&quot; type=&quot;XXXXAction&quot; paramert=&quot;method&quot; validate=&quot;true&quot; 另 ...
使用SOLR加入中文同义词需要把synonyms.txt的默认编码改成与自己系统使用的编码一致。 比如说:你整个系统的编码都是用UTF-8,那么你就要把synonyms.txt这个文件的编码格式转换成UTF-8。原因是,对某个词进行同义的时候找到的词是乱码,而乱码在对于的索引中是没有存在的。这也就导致了中文不可以使用的原因。 总结:SOLR中文分词无法使用,核心问题是-没有统一编码,导致乱码问题。
   Command定义如下: 将来自客户端的请求传入一个对象,无需了解这个请求激活的动作或有关接受这个请求的处理细节。 是不是有点迷糊。不知其说的是啥。哈哈。别着急下面听我慢慢到来。 本人觉得,命令模式就是把一些具体的命令封装成一批具体的类,这批类实现同一个接口或者是抽象类。然后把这些类组织到起,然后统一来执行,完成一个具体的业务流程。 它的优点是:解藕了发送者与接收者之间的联系。发送者调用一个操作,接收者接受请求执行相应的动作,说白了就是调用一个具体的类来执行相应的方法。因为使用Command模式解耦,发送者无需知道接受者任何接口。 比如说,对文件进行操作,如打开、关闭、打印。正常的 ...
Global site tag (gtag.js) - Google Analytics